как разобрать ответ MDNS? - PullRequest
1 голос
/ 01 февраля 2012

У нас есть несколько устройств (например, IP-камеры) в сети.Я пишу API на C, чтобы найти эти камеры.Эти камеры поддерживают многоадресный DNS-запрос.У меня есть формат для запроса, но у меня нет общего формата ответа.чтобы я мог написать API, который может анализировать ответы на запросы MDNS.Может у кого-то есть парсер MDNS, желательно реализованный на С или точный формат ответа.Спасибо

1 Ответ

2 голосов
/ 01 февраля 2012

ответов mDNS форматируются в соответствии со стандартными ответами DNS, описанными в RFC1035 .

См. Также Multicast DNS RFC6762 , в частности разделы 16, 17, 18 и 19, которые охватывают некоторые различия с Unicast DNS (например, допускаются более длинные сообщения, допускается более широкий набор символов).

...